DEVICE FOR ONLINE MONITORING OF AUTOMATIC MEDIUM AND HIGH VOLTAGE CIRCUIT BREAKER Russian patent published in 2018 - IPC G01R31/327 

Abstract RU 2665819 C2

FIELD: control systems.

SUBSTANCE: invention relates to monitoring the condition of circuit breaker (2). Essence: the device contains injection unit (51) for injecting a transient test signal to the first contact of the circuit breaker, detection unit (52) for detecting the resulting transient signal at the second contact of the circuit breaker, first coupling means (53) for coupling the transient test signal provided by the injection unit to first contact (21) and second coupling means (54) for coupling the detection unit to second contact (22) in order to receive the resulting test signal. At least one of the first and second coupling means provides galvanic separation from first and second contacts (21, 22). Wherein coupling means (53) are connected between first contact (21) and ground, and second coupling means (54) are connected between second contact (22) and ground.

EFFECT: ensuring real-time monitoring of the ablation level of the contact areas of the arcing contacts.

22 cl, 5 dwg
